How to set "versions" when creating ticket using Python API

Craig Anderson
Contributor
March 8, 2023 edited

I'm attempting to set the "versions" field in a Jira ticket.

I'm using the Python API:

ticket = {
...
ticket['versions'] = [{'name': '1.0.0'}]
}
jira_cilent.create_issue(ticket)

 

I get:

"errors":{"components":"The list contains an invalid value"}

I checked: 1.0.0 is a valid choice.

Actually, that is the correct code for setting the multiple choice version.

The problem was something else.
